TNK-BP boosts oil output by 10% in H1 in Orenburg region

ORENBURG. July 19 (Interfax) - TNK-BP increased oil production by 9.8% year-on-year to 9.7 million tonnes in January-June 2010 in the Orenburg region, the company's subsidiary OJSC Orenburgneft said in a statement.

Gas output in January-June came to over 1.2 billion cubic meters, which was a year-on-year increase of 3%.

Geological and technical efforts supporting the increase in oil output was carried out at 597 wells, which was an boost of 2.9% from 2009.

TNK-BP's made asset in the Orenburg region is OJSC Orenburgneft, which produces oil in five regions: Buzuluk, Buguruslan, Sorochinsk, Pervomaisky and Murmanayevsk.
